The Issue
Rhode Island is currently facing a serious issue with excessively high energy prices, causing significant strain on residents, particularly families, seniors, and small businesses. Rhode Islanders, like many across the nation, are already grappling with the rising costs of living, and inflated energy prices only exacerbate the situation. These elevated costs are forcing some families to choose between heating their homes, buying groceries, or paying for healthcare. This is an unbearable situation that requires urgent intervention.
In recent years, energy costs in Rhode Island have consistently risen faster than the national average. According to the U.S. Energy Information Administration, the state consistently ranks in the top tier for residential energy rates. This trend is unsustainable and unfair, especially for those living on fixed incomes who are the hardest hit. The Rhode Island Public Utilities Commission and the Rhode Island General Assembly have the power to address this urgent matter through policy reforms.
We propose several actionable solutions to alleviate this financial burden on our community. Firstly, implementing rate reductions can provide immediate relief to those most affected by high energy costs. Secondly, increasing transparency in rate structures will allow consumers to better understand and manage their energy expenses. Lastly, providing subsidies or financial assistance to low-income households can ensure that energy is accessible and affordable to all residents, especially those in dire need.
